Solution

The correct option is B 1/6
Since the rulers of Mahajanapadas used to build huge forts and upheld large armies, they were always in need of resources. So, rather than depending on occasional gifts brought by the people, they collected regular taxes from the people. Now, since most of the people are farmers then, the taxes collected by the farmers were the most important form of revenue for the rajas. It was fixed at one-sixth of the total produce. Apart from farmers, such taxes were also imposed on craftsmen, hunters, gatherers, traders etc. in different forms.
